From: Roland Dreier <roland@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xx> LIO core uses data_direction in the opposite way that qla2xxx needs; for example, to the LIO core, a READ command is getting data from the target so it uses DMA_FROM_DEVICE; however for the HBA to be able to DMA the data to respond to the READ command, the buffer should be mapped with DMA_TO_DEVICE (since data is flowing from memory to the HBA). This causes problems on systems with a real IOMMU; eg with VT-d (intel_iommu) enabled, one sees messages like DMAR:[DMA Read] Request device [06:00.0] fault addr ffe4e000 DMAR:[fault reason 06] PTE Read access is not set and the target is not able to transfer any data. Fix this by adding a function tcm_qla2xxx_mapping_dir() that converts from the LIO core direction to the value that qla2xxx needs to use.
